MCP6544-I/ST Specifications

  • Type
    Parameter
  • Supplier Device Package
    14-TSSOP
  • Mounting Type
    Surface Mount
  • Package / Case
    14-TSSOP (0.173", 4.40mm Width)
  • Operating Temperature
    -40°C ~ 85°C
  • Hysteresis
    6.5mV
  • Propagation Delay (Max)
    8µs
  • CMRR, PSRR (Typ)
    70dB CMRR, 80dB PSRR
  • Current - Quiescent (Max)
    1µA
  • Current - Output (Typ)
    -
  • Current - Input Bias (Max)
    1pA @ 5.5V
  • Voltage - Input Offset (Max)
    7mV @ 5.5V
  • Voltage - Supply, Single/Dual (±)
    1.6V ~ 5.5V
  • Output Type
    CMOS, Push-Pull, Rail-to-Rail, TTL
  • Number of Elements
    4
  • Type
    General Purpose
  • Packaging
    Tube
  • Product Status
    Active

The MCP6544-I/ST is a quad comparator integrated circuit chip manufactured by Microchip Technology. It offers several advantages and can be applied in various scenarios. Here are some of its advantages and application scenarios:Advantages: 1. Low power consumption: The MCP6544-I/ST operates at a low supply voltage range of 1.6V to 5.5V, making it suitable for battery-powered applications where power efficiency is crucial. 2. Rail-to-rail input and output: It provides rail-to-rail input and output capability, allowing it to operate with signals close to the supply voltage rails, maximizing the dynamic range and accuracy of the comparator. 3. Low propagation delay: The MCP6544-I/ST has a low propagation delay of 8.5 μs, enabling fast response times in applications that require quick decision-making based on input signals. 4. Small package size: It is available in a small 14-pin TSSOP package, making it suitable for space-constrained applications.Application Scenarios: 1. Battery-powered devices: The low power consumption and wide supply voltage range of the MCP6544-I/ST make it ideal for battery-powered devices such as portable medical equipment, handheld instruments, and wireless sensors. 2. Signal conditioning: It can be used in signal conditioning circuits to compare and process analog signals, such as in audio amplifiers, level detectors, and voltage monitoring circuits. 3. Motor control: The MCP6544-I/ST can be utilized in motor control applications to monitor and control the speed, direction, or position of motors, ensuring precise and efficient operation. 4. Industrial automation: It can be employed in industrial automation systems for tasks like monitoring and controlling process variables, detecting faults, or triggering alarms based on sensor inputs. 5. Automotive electronics: The MCP6544-I/ST can find applications in automotive electronics, such as in vehicle safety systems, battery management systems, or engine control units, where its low power consumption and small package size are advantageous.These are just a few examples of the advantages and application scenarios of the MCP6544-I/ST integrated circuit chip. Its versatility and features make it suitable for a wide range of applications where low power consumption, rail-to-rail operation, and small form factor are essential.
